Appoints a committee to notify the House of Representatives that the Senate is organized.
The bill resolves that the Presiding Officer of the Senate appoint a committee of two members to inform the House of Representatives that the Senate is organized and ready to conduct business. This notification is a procedural step in the legislative process.
